The figure 12.19200 meters is not an arbitrary number; it is the direct result of converting a round Imperial measurement into the metric system using the defined conversion factor.
The use of two trailing zeros indicates that the measurement is considered "exact" or "high-precision." In a practical context, this suggests the object measured is exactly 40 feet long, and the metric representation is being calculated to a high degree of exactitude, likely for compatibility with metric-based manufacturing specifications or international engineering standards.
You have almost certainly seen 12.19200 meters without knowing it. Every time a truck passes you on a highway carrying a corrugated steel box with twist-lock corners, you are looking at the physical embodiment of that measurement.
